Her lightweight construction, generous bridge deck clearance, and comprehensive sail wardrobe deliver unique performance under sail of approximately 80% of wind speed. One of "3 Weeks'" key features includes her upgraded 40 HP Yanmar diesel engines with very low 700 hours, providing plenty of power when needed and reliable cruising speeds of 8 knots under power.
The closed cockpit provides a comfortable and safe space for offshore passages, with twin helms offering excellent visibility for sail trimming and watchkeeping. Inside, the light and airy saloon features a quality fit out with an L-shaped lounge, additional bench seats that double as eskys, and an aft facing navigation station.
Being the 3 cabin owner's version, the port hull houses a full sized bathroom with a separate shower, midships storage solutions, and a double berth forward. The starboard hull features a low set double berth aft, a functional bench top galley midships with great lighting and visibility through fixed window panes, and a double berth forward with an ensuite head and sink.
